Trump did on 60 Minutes what he does every time. He spews a blizzard of lies, exaggerations and assorted other falsehoods, and if (as usual) the reporter isn’t equipped or doesn’t bother to push back, he keeps going.

Here is a detailed list, via @mehdirhasan.bsky.social
https://bsky.app/profile/did:plc:j53tav4pdcpfxyx2gcfr5fhb

https://zeteo.com/p/factchecking-trump-on-60-minutes

• "We have no inflation." Inflation is at 3%.
• "It's at 2%. It's-- it's the perfect inflation." Inflation is at 3%.
• "Right now [grocery prices are] going down." Grocery prices are up 1.4% since
Trump came to office.
• "A year ago, we were a dead country." Not only did the US have the fastest-growing economy in the G7 in both 2023 and 2024, but the Economist magazine called it "the envy of the world."
• "11,888 murderers were let into our country." Not only is this number inaccurate, but many of the non-citizens convicted of homicide either here or abroad came in during Trump's first term.
• "Washington, DC, was... almost like a crime capital of the world." In 2023, per PolitiFact, "at least 49 other cities in the world had higher homicide rates.
• "[Biden] hardly went anywhere. Guy couldn't leave his bedroom." Not only did Joe Biden visit roughly as many countries in his term of office as Trump did in his first term, but Biden was the first US president to visit an active warzone - Ukraine - not under the control of US forces.
• "I made Middle East peace. For 3,000 years, they couldn't do it." There is no peace in Palestine, no peace deal in place, and it isn't a 3,000-year-old conflict.
• "Communist, not socialist. Communist. He's far worse than a socialist."
Zohran Mamdani is not a communist.
• "I can't give them $1.5 trillion so that they can give welfare to people that came into our country illegally." The Trump/GOP claim that Democrats want to give free healthcare to undocumented immigrants has been repeatedly debunked.
• "They emptied their mental institutions and their insane asylums-- into the United States of America." Asylum seekers don't come from "insane asylums."
Obviously.
• "One thing I can tell you, the 2020 election was rigged." It wasn't. The courts agreed.
• "And a lotta people say when it's rigged you're allowed to do it again." A lot of people don't say this. The US Constitution doesn't, for sure.
